HLA-DRB1 alleles and shared amino acid sequences in disease susceptibility and severity in patients from eastern France with rheumatoid arthritis.

作者信息

Toussirot E, Auge B, Tiberghien P, Chabod J, Cedoz J P, Wendling D

机构信息

Department of Rheumatology, University Hospital, Besançon, France.

出版信息

J Rheumatol. 1999 Jul;26(7):1446-51.

Abstract

OBJECTIVE

To examine the effects of HLA-DRB1 alleles and amino acid sequences that carry the shared epitope (SE) upon rheumatoid arthritis (RA) susceptibility and disease severity in patients from Eastern France.

METHODS

HLA-DRB1 alleles were determined in 120 patients and 104 healthy controls by polymerase chain reaction/sequence specific oligonucleotide probes. Subtyping of DRB1*01 and *04 were performed using sequence specific primers. Patients were retrospectively evaluated for disease duration, age at disease onset, presence of rheumatoid factors, subcutaneous nodules, vasculitis and other extraarticular diseases, for the need for arthroplasty and immunosuppressive/immunoregulatory agents, and for radiographic damage.

RESULTS

The prevalence of HLA-DRB104 was significantly higher in patients (46.6%) than in controls (17.3%) (Pcorr = 0.000003). HLA-DRB10101 and *0401 were the most prominently associated subtypes in patients with RA (33.3%, Pcorr = 0.011, and 28.3%, Pcorr = 0.00008, respectively). A significant fraction of patients (72.5%) expressed one or 2 copies of the SE (p < 0.0000001; OR 4.77, CI 2.61-8.78). The presence of double SE was associated with a higher risk of developing RA (OR 4.83, CI 1.91-12.71; p = 0.0001). No significant differences in the clinical records among patients expressing no RA linked alleles, one and 2 copies of the SE, were observed. However, analyzing the specific effect of each amino acid sequence, we observed a significant association of the QKRAA motif with vasculitis (p = 0.03) and history of joint replacement surgery (p = 0.05), suggesting a role for lysine in position 71 of the shared sequence.

CONCLUSION

These findings differ from those of previous HLA-DRB1 allele studies in patients with RA from other regions of France. Thus, the heterogeneity in both the expression of DRB1 alleles and the association of these alleles with disease severity could be relevant within a country such as France.

摘要

目的

研究HLA - DRB1等位基因及携带共同表位(SE)的氨基酸序列对法国东部类风湿关节炎(RA)患者易感性及疾病严重程度的影响。

方法

采用聚合酶链反应/序列特异性寡核苷酸探针法,对120例患者和104例健康对照者进行HLA - DRB1等位基因检测。使用序列特异性引物对DRB101和04进行亚型分型。回顾性评估患者的病程、发病年龄、类风湿因子、皮下结节、血管炎及其他关节外疾病的存在情况,是否需要进行关节成形术以及使用免疫抑制/免疫调节药物,以及影像学损伤情况。

结果

患者中HLA - DRB104的患病率(46.6%)显著高于对照组(17.3%)(校正P值 = 0.000003)。HLA - DRB10101和*0401是RA患者中最显著相关的亚型(分别为33.3%,校正P值 = 0.011;28.3%,校正P值 = 0.00008)。相当一部分患者(72.5%)表达1个或2个拷贝的SE(p < 0.0000001;比值比4.77,可信区间2.61 - 8.78)。双SE的存在与发生RA的较高风险相关(比值比4.83,可信区间1.91 - 12.71;p = 0.0001)。在未表达与RA相关等位基因、表达1个拷贝SE和2个拷贝SE的患者之间,临床记录未观察到显著差异。然而,分析每个氨基酸序列的具体作用时,我们观察到QKRAA基序与血管炎(p = 0.03)及关节置换手术史(p = 0.05)显著相关,提示共同序列第71位的赖氨酸起作用。

结论

这些发现与法国其他地区RA患者先前的HLA - DRB1等位基因研究结果不同。因此,在法国这样的国家,DRB1等位基因表达及这些等位基因与疾病严重程度的关联存在异质性可能具有重要意义。
